Scientifically proven effective at skin rejuvenation

Microneedling, also known as collagen induction therapy, is an aesthetic treatment using a unique roller or device with tiny needles to prick the skin and create minute holes in the dermis layer. By sending the body into repair mode, collagen production increases to improve fine lines, wrinkles, and other skin imperfections. With the additional step of platelet-rich plasma (PRP) being introduced to the skin after microneedling, the concentrated formula enhances the results and accelerates the body's natural healing process.

Easy treatment session

A handheld device will move smoothly across the face, making tiny lesions or holes in the skin. Afterward, a topical treatment of platelet-rich plasma is gently massaged into place for deeper penetration of nutrients and spur on collagen production. This aesthetic treatment generally takes 30 – 60 minutes while patients lay comfortably in one of our private treatment rooms at Xage Medical Spa.

Low risk and safe treatment

Once a patient's small blood sample is taken, the plasma is separated from red and white blood cells. The highly concentrated platelets are used to promote tissue healing and new cell growth. Microneedling with PRP is a low-risk procedure for a rejection or allergic reaction due to using a patient's own plasma.

Natural results

The topical application of PRP after microneedling integrates itself into a patient's skin tissue, spreading evenly and smoothly across the face. In about 4 – 6 weeks, patients will notice visible improvements in the appearance and health of their skin. It provides natural, glowing results, and the effects are long-lasting, around 6 – 12 months. Results will vary by patient and are dependent on how fast a patient's body destructs collagen production.

Minimal recovery

After each session, some redness and swelling will occur but should subside in about 4 – 6 days. Patients can return to work the next day. Women can even wear light makeup or concealer to minimize any temporary uneven skin tones. Simply cleanse skin once a day and apply moisturizer as needed, along with wearing daily sunscreen to protect from sun exposure.

Who can benefit from microneedling with PRP?

Overall, microneedling with PRP is safe and effective for almost anyone. However, it is not recommended for women during pregnancy or patients currently taking acne medication. Individuals with minor to moderate skin imperfections can reduce the appearance of these issues while boosting collagen and elastin production. In some cases, patients should plan on 4 – 6 maintenance treatments, spaced out every 4 – 6 weeks, for better overall skin health and optimal results.
